AN evening bat walk rounds off a long day of wildlife activities at a North-East nature reserve on Sunday.

The Exploring Your Environment project has teamed up with Durham Wildlife Trust to run free dawn-till-dusk events at Low Barns, near Witton-le-Wear.

They start with a dawn chorus walk at 4.30am and include pond dipping, wildflower identification and bird spotting.

Although people can drop in at any time until 8pm, places on the dawn walk must be booked by calling 0191-584-3112.

Visitors should wear outdoor clothing and children must have an adult with them.

Exploring Your Environment aims to encourage people to learn about the environment. The three-year Newcastle University project is managed by Tyne and Wear Museums and sponsored by Northumbrian Water, with £226,500 from the Heritage Lottery Fund
